Torian shows his class
Reggie Torian doesn't have the international titles and achievements that belong to hurdling rivals Allen Johnson, Colin Jackson and Mark Crear. But he showed on Sunday why he could be joining them in 1999. Torian beat all three to become the fastest in the world this year over 110 metres.

El Kaouch wins
Adil El Kaouch broke the Kenyan strangle hold on the men's distance events here today, winning Morocco's first ever gold at the World Junior Championships when he triumphed in the 1,500 metres. The championships also ended with the unlikely result of the American men returning without a gold medal as Australia's 4x400 metres team imposed the first ever defeat on the United States in the event since the championships began in 1986.

Malaysian Open
Six Indian women golfers would participate in the Malaysian Open (amateur) golf championship, starting tomorrow. India has fielded two teams of three players each for this prestigious tournament at the Awana Golf and Country Club in Jenting highlands in Malaysia, which will conclude on August 6.

Aarthi firm
Asian sub-junior girls champion Aarthi Ramaswamy (7) of Tamil Nadu was assured of the title with a round to spare after taking a full one point lead on the eighth and penultimate round of the eighth National u-18 chess championship today.

Wills takes over
First came the Omega Asian Professional Golf Association Tour at the continental level, and now the Wills Tour on the national level. The Professional Golf Association of India today extended the idea by announcing Wills Sport, as the umbrella sponsor for the tour on the lines of the better known Omega Tour in Asia and the Nike Tour in United States.
